The Saudi Arabia railway sleepers market encounters several challenges that impact the reliability and longevity of railway systems. One of the foremost challenges is sourcing materials that can withstand the arid climate and resist deterioration from sand, heat, and other environmental factors. Ensuring that railway sleepers meet safety standards and can accommodate various types of tracks and loads is also crucial. Additionally, the market faces challenges in terms of sustainable sourcing and manufacturing practices, as well as addressing the maintenance and replacement needs of sleepers over time to ensure the safety and efficiency of the rail network.
The railway sleepers market in Saudi Arabia was affected by the COVID-19 pandemic due to disruptions in construction activities and transportation projects. As economies slowed down and infrastructure projects were put on hold, the demand for railway sleepers used in rail and metro systems declined. Supply chain disruptions and labor shortages further impacted the market. However, with the resumption of transportation projects and public infrastructure investments, the market started to recover. The demand for railway sleepers was influenced by the revival of construction activities and efforts to modernize transportation networks.
